Background
Tuberculosis is a disease caused by infection of tubercle bacillus. The infected parts are classified into pulmonary tuberculosis, lymphoid tuberculosis, bone tuberculosis, etc., and other parts such as kidney may be infected with tuberculosis. Tuberculosis is a disease with high morbidity and strong infectivity, and is mainly pulmonary tuberculosis at present.
Tuberculosis is an infectious disease, the infection source is mainly the bacteria excretion of patients with open tuberculosis, and the sputum contains mycobacterium tuberculosis, which is the infection source and is mainly transmitted by short-distance droplet. Therefore, in the tuberculosis ward, sputum of a patient has great infectivity, and needs to be treated.
General sputum processing apparatus is sputum jar or box for, and patient tells the sputum to processing apparatus in, though sealed lid is sealed, can not volatilize in the air, but also only play a temporary storage's effect, does not carry out purification treatment to the sputum, when opening sealed lid again, the sputum still can volatilize in the air to the sputum volume is more in the processing apparatus, and the infectivity is stronger more. There is also a treatment device which integrates the purification and storage of sputum, but the device has large volume, complex internal structure and inconvenient installation and maintenance, and is not suitable for small wards.
Therefore, there is a need to provide a sputum processing device for tuberculosis ward to solve the above problems.

This tuberculosis ward saliva processing apparatus includes: a sputum receiving purifier 1, a storage box 2 and a disinfection box 3.
The top of the sputum-receiving purifier 1 is provided with an openable sealing cover 11, the middle part of the inner side surface of the sealing cover 11 is provided with an ultraviolet disinfection lamp 20, the outer side surface is provided with a handle 21, and the inner side surface of the sealing cover 11 is provided with sealing strips at the parts contacted with the sputum-receiving purifier 1. The bottom of the sputum receiving purifier 1 is of a funnel-shaped structure, a funnel opening 12 of the funnel-shaped structure is connected with a liquid descending pipe 13, and the lower end of the liquid descending pipe 13 penetrates through a pipeline inlet 6 and is inserted into the storage box 2.
A universal head bracket is fixedly arranged on the outer wall of one side of the sputum-receiving purifier 1. The universal head support comprises a fixed frame 14, a universal head 15 and a telescopic frame which are connected in sequence, wherein one end of the fixed frame 14, which is far away from the universal head 15, is fixedly connected with the side wall of the sputum-collecting purifier 1. The telescopic frame comprises an inner rod 16 and an outer sleeve rod 17, one end of the inner rod 16 is inserted into the outer sleeve rod 17 and fixed through a screw 18, the other end of the inner rod is connected with the universal head 15, and one end, far away from the universal head 15, of the outer sleeve rod 17 is provided with a sucker 19.
This tuberculosis ward saliva processing apparatus, according to ward size and furnishings during the installation, connect phlegm clarifier accessible sucking disc paste locate wall body, cabinet body on, also can directly paste and establish on the top sealing cover of storage box or disinfect box, storage box and disinfect box set up in near corner or bed bottom, and the installation is nimble convenient. During the use, the patient rotates whole phlegm purification ware through the regulation of direction lever and universal head, makes its top slope to oneself, then opens the sealed lid at top, tells the sputum in connecing the phlegm purification ware, then closes and covers sealed lid, starts the liquid pump after that, makes the antiseptic solution in the disinfect box flow out from the shower nozzle through the drain pipe, erodees and connects the phlegm purification ware, and the disinfectant fluid after scouring flows into the storage box from the downcomer and concentrates at last and topple over the processing. And (3) adding the disinfectant in the disinfection box at night, treating the wastewater in the storage box, turning on the ultraviolet disinfection lamp, irradiating for half an hour to one hour, and disinfecting the sputum purifier.
